Key Insights

  • Select layers to access available options and effects.
  • Use the selection tool (shortcut V) for efficiency.
  • Grayed out options indicate unselected layers or compositions.
  • Utilize the space bar for temporary access to the hand tool.
  • Modify and save custom workspaces for personalized setups.
  • Panels can be rearranged and resized for better workflow.
  • Reopen closed panels via the workspace menu or window menu.
  • Understand the function of different tools in the toolbar.
  • Use mouse scroll wheel for zooming instead of the zoom tool.
  • Remember shortcuts to enhance productivity across Adobe apps.
